The tank is 3.5 months old. It is a 46 gal bow front. 2x96watt PC 50/50. CPR bakpak skimmer. 2 rio 600 and 1 penguin 660(came with tank and totally sucks), 65lbs LR 40lbs LS.

Current occupants

yellow tang (about 3 years old)
flame angel
cleaner shrimp (molted 5 times in 2 months)
2 conch's
4 turbos
3 blue leg hermits (4 more in skimmer box)
tons of stomatellas
5 or 6 tiny starfish hitchers
2 or 3 bristle worms hitchers
some other unidentified hitchers
xenia
mushrooms 2 types
button polyps
zoas
montipora digita
GSP
galaxia
frogspawn
candy coral
encrusting gorgorian
caulerpa of 3 flavors

Everything is going smoothly. I aquired alot of frags recently, thus the large quantity and unexpected diversity of small corals. At about the time that I was given some very nice frags, tiny ones started growing out of the rock so I have a pretty good albeit unexpected arrival of a few different types of corals. Once I get the overflow, the skimmer will be moved to the sump. I have a very narrow stand so the sump will be a 13 gallon, tall, garbage can under the tank in the middle partition of the stand. I plan on putting about 3 inches of sand in the sump with a few chunks of base rock and a small light over it. Anyhow it is still a work in progress.

If by the diatom bloom you mean the hard green algae that is on the glass I have it already. My snails are working hard at night and thus I think the reason for the population explosion of my stomatellas. I had a bit of cyno but I think my pods are handling that well, I also readjusted the flow when I saw it. That is why that one power head is so low in the tank on the right side. Well, that and it just sucks. Free PH though so why waste it right? Put it to as good of a use as I can find for it lol.
